Subject: Password Reset Revamp — ready for staging sign-off

Hi all — the reworked reset flow for Keldway Accounts is staged and fully tested. Changes: single-use links now expire in 15 minutes, the legacy security-question path is removed, and all reset events are audit-logged. Rollback plan is documented in the runbook and was rehearsed yesterday. Release manager: please confirm the staging build before we schedule production. The candidate build is identified by the token below.

pipeline stamp: htk4_ae36

Subject: Trace propagation for Fennelwick plugins

Hi all,

Starting next sprint, all plugin requests through the Murlow gateway must forward the `traceparent` header so we can stitch spans across services. Our docs cover the header format and sampling rules. To test end-to-end against the partner sandbox, send requests to the tracing echo endpoint and authenticate with the bearer token below.

portal login ticket: eyJhbGciOiJIUzI1NiIsInR5cCI6IkpXVCJ9.eyJzdWIiOiIMjvRAf3PEFIn0.nuv9gjixLtnr

**Archive Room B2 — Contractor Access**

The Hollowmere House archive room is in basement level B2, past the plant room. Visiting contractors must sign in at the loading dock desk first. No tools stored overnight. Door is on a timed lock between 18:00 and 07:00; outside those hours use the keypad beside the frame. Report any fault to the dock supervisor. The current keypad code is below.

door code, kawip-bagap: bdg-HQEWH-4

Subject: Schema registry cut-over — done

Team,

Cut-over from the legacy event catalog to Brindlehook Registry finished Tuesday night. All producers now publish against registry-validated schemas; the old catalog is read-only until end of month. Two consumers (billing-sync, audit-fan) needed compat shims, both merged. No dropped events during the window. Rollback path stays live for two weeks. For the sync, note the registry settings every service must point at are listed below.

settings of kajep-kawip:
[zorys]
host = zorys.urlaqgrid.corp
user = zorys_svc
database = zorys_prod